About this school

Macon County High School is a State/Public serving high age pupils, located in Lafayette, Macon County. The school has 967 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Macon County school district. It serves grades 9โ€“12 in a small-town setting. The school employs 54.3 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 17.8:1. 32% of students are proficient in reading. 21% are proficient in maths. The four-year graduation rate is 87%. The school offers 8 AP courses, dual enrollment, a gifted and talented program.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Macon County High School is one of 8 schools in Macon County, based in Lafayette, Tennessee. The district serves 4,216 students district-wide and employs 258 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 967 students, Macon County High School is larger than the district average of about 527 students per school.
